The annual salary statistics of diagnostic medical sonographers in San Juan-Caguas-Guaynabo, Puerto Rico is shown in Table 1. The wage information of diagnostic medical sonographers in San Juan-Caguas-Guaynabo is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$22,280 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$23,290 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$29,020 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$29,590 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$36,940 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for diagnostic medical sonographers in San Juan-Caguas-Guaynabo, Puerto Rico in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$36,940.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$29,020.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$22,280.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of diagnostic medical sonographers from 2012 to 2021.
|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 9-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2021 | $29,020 | 16.30% | 9.34% |
| 2020 | $24,290 | 3.38% | - |
| 2019 | $23,470 | -6.48% | - |
| 2018 | $24,990 | 13.77% | - |
| 2017 | $21,550 | -1.67% | - |
| 2016 | $21,910 | -10.09% | - |
| 2015 | $24,120 | -4.15% | - |
| 2014 | $25,120 | -5.21% | - |
| 2013 | $26,430 | 0.45% | - |
| 2012 | $26,310 | - | - |
